as a footnote...
UV is the most powerful bleaching agent there is
with that in mind following the bleached path...
now down south you'll see for example, a Formula that the UV has given the same yellow "nicko'teen'd" appearance to the rocker switch covers, wheel hub, speaker covers
those are pigment inducted plastics and are the weakest for holding the color
could be red, it would bleach out to pink of whatever
It's just that white when it gives up enough color becomes somewhat "transparent" and you see the off white base stock plastic
my vote is for some idiot went at that boat with a tub/tile/toilet/clorox clean-up whatever way too liberally and did irreversable damage.
